Clean up generated files before FPGA build
This commit is contained in:
parent
4d79fecfdc
commit
604766ab3b
|
@ -1,18 +1,22 @@
|
||||||
#!/bin/bash
|
#!/bin/bash
|
||||||
|
|
||||||
set -e
|
set -e
|
||||||
|
set -o pipefail
|
||||||
|
|
||||||
. script_env
|
. script_env
|
||||||
setup_vivado
|
setup_vivado
|
||||||
|
|
||||||
rm -f puzzlefw_top.bit.bin redpitaya_puzzlefw.xsa
|
rm -f puzzlefw_top.bit.bin redpitaya_puzzlefw.xsa
|
||||||
|
rm -rf vivado/redpitaya_puzzlefw.srcs/sources_1/bd/puzzlefw/ip
|
||||||
|
rm -rf vivado/redpitaya_puzzlefw.srcs/sources_1/bd/puzzlefw/ipshared
|
||||||
|
rm -rf vivado/redpitaya_puzzlefw.gen
|
||||||
|
rm -rf vivado/output
|
||||||
|
|
||||||
|
mkdir -p vivado/output
|
||||||
|
|
||||||
( cd vivado
|
( cd vivado
|
||||||
mkdir -p output
|
|
||||||
stdbuf -oL vivado -mode batch -source nonproject.tcl | tee output/build_log.txt )
|
stdbuf -oL vivado -mode batch -source nonproject.tcl | tee output/build_log.txt )
|
||||||
|
|
||||||
rm -f vivado/output/puzzlefw_top.bit.bin
|
|
||||||
|
|
||||||
cat >vivado/output/bitstream.bif <<EOF
|
cat >vivado/output/bitstream.bif <<EOF
|
||||||
all:
|
all:
|
||||||
{
|
{
|
||||||
|
|
Loading…
Reference in New Issue